In article <1990Jan29.140512.17217@arnor.uucp> SUHLER@IBM.COM writes:
>I'm looking for a program that will forecast income, etc. for several
>years in the future.  Example:  How much will I have accrued from an
>investment if it yields 9% this year, 9.5% for the next two years, 8.5%
>for the fourth year, etc.  Unless I missed a feature, programs like
>Managing Your Money only allow a constant rate of interest/income.

Well, sure, but you can do the above in three steps or so even on a pocket
calculator, like the calculator DA:

	1.095 * = * 1.09 * 1.08.5 =

If you need more accuracy (e.g. "compounded daily"), you can still use MYM
or a similar program in a few steps.
